Norwegian Cruise Line has confirmed the cancellation of numerous Norwegian Viva sailings spanning several months through the middle of 2028. These cancellations were publicly announced in early June 2026 and affect voyages previously scheduled during this extended period.

Alongside these cancellations, the cruise operator is relocating the Caribbean homeport for the Norwegian Viva from San Juan, Puerto Rico, to Miami, Florida. This move means that passengers with bookings on the affected sailings may need to revise their travel arrangements to depart from Miami instead of San Juan.
